Output 017214674866807760f281a3f611b56a0290bc2fe305ea7ac89c2eae706d9518:1

value
174263582
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a6177aaa75e572507179c638702622cdc0a4c21 OP_EQUAL
address
3QWucf8wgTn5sk2Y6VWucPG31HfBEdCPgU
transaction
017214674866807760f281a3f611b56a0290bc2fe305ea7ac89c2eae706d9518
spent
true